Impact & Evaluation Managers measure whether nonprofit programs are achieving their intended outcomes, building data systems and evaluation frameworks that demonstrate effectiveness to funders and inform program improvement.

Collect and manage program data
Automates✓ Now

What you do today

Oversee data collection systems—client intake forms, service tracking, outcome surveys, and follow-up assessments. Ensure data quality, train staff on data entry, and manage databases.

AI that applies

AI validates data quality in real-time, flags missing or inconsistent entries, and automates data cleaning processes. NLP extracts structured data from narrative case notes.

Analyze outcomes data and generate insights
Automates✓ Now

What you do today

Perform statistical analysis on program data—pre/post comparisons, trend analysis, disaggregated outcomes by demographic. Identify what's working, for whom, and under what conditions.

AI that applies

AI performs automated statistical analysis, identifies significant outcome patterns, and generates visualizations that make complex data accessible to non-technical stakeholders.

Design and implement program evaluation frameworks
Enhances◐ 1–3 yrs

What you do today

Develop logic models, theories of change, and evaluation plans for each program. Define measurable outcomes, select appropriate indicators, and design data collection methods that are rigorous but practical.

AI that applies

AI suggests evaluation indicators based on program type and funder requirements, identifies validated measurement tools from research databases, and generates logic model templates.
